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Цитата:
Сообщение от
karpuk_av
Поражаюсь энергии автора. Задумал - сделал. У меня на этот процесс уходят месяцы. Но если автору и всем остальным интересно посмотреть как можно сделать привод монитора и кнопаньки на руле посмотрите
здесь
Спасибо конечно за ссылку но дело не в том что мой привод не работает. Даже наоборот очень тихо быстро и стабильно( жаль что не заснял перед смертью матрицы на видео, потом просто раздербанил конструкцию от досады).
Пришлось отказаться по той причине что была убита матрица а у новокупленной оказался слишком кароткий шлейф. поколхозив с удлиннениями стабильной работы не добился и решил зделать без привода. На руле есть штатные кнопки.
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Цитата:
Сообщение от
XsanderS
... у новокупленной оказался слишком кароткий шлейф.
По этой причене у меня выезжает монитор в сборе.
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Цитата:
Сообщение от
karpuk_av
По этой причене у меня выезжает монитор в сборе.
У меня так не получается, места не хватает.
Вложений: 1
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Подправил программу под I-Bus
Вложений: 2
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Наконец слепил и отладил прошивку для Carduino под свой проект! развел платку.
Что реализовано:
1. 8 сенсорных кнопок которые разместятся по сторонам монитора и служат для управления основными функциями магнитолы, включением и перезапуском компа.
2. морда магнитолы полностью убрал. Блоки кнопок реализованы на Carduino след образом: всего на магнитоле 18 кнопок для них задействованы соответственно 18 дигитальных выходов Carduino. Что дает возможность настраивать их как угодно, хоть с компа хоть с сенсорных кнопок хоть с рулевых кнопок рулевые кнопки общаются по IBus Шине).
3. Настроено соединение компа с IBus шиной как прием данных так и запись в шину с использованием МС TH3122.
4. Управление рулевыми кнопками компом и магнитолой. В режиме AUX данные идущие от рулевых кнопок через Carduino идут в комп и управляют назначенными в нем комбинациями клавы. В остальных режимах CD и FM данные от рулевых кнопок управляют соответствующими пинами Carduino на которых висят кнопки магнитолы.
кроме одной кнопки которая не зависимо от режима магнитолы работает на переключение режимов AUX/CD/FM
5. Симулятор енкодера, все привязывают енкодер на Carduino я же наоборот. так как громкость на магнитоле регулировалась енкодером, я из соображений дизайна не стал его лепить на панель и симулировал с помощью Carduino. Теперь звук регулируеться сенсорными кнопками и кнопками с руля.
6. Данные дисплея магнитолы идут через Carduino по ISP шине в комп где будут отображаться в спец написанной проге.
7. Так же реализовано управление компом через все тот же Carduino с помощью IR пульта.
Получаем следующую картину: если отключить комп, не важно по какой причине на звук в машине это никак не повлияет. Магнитола в этом случае все так же управляется сенсорными кнопками и в режимах CD/FM с кнопок руля.
Когда комп в рабочем состоянии то все также но в режиме AUX кнопки руля управляют компом а сенсорные магнитолой.
Теперь можно наконец приступить к изготовлению новой рамки с щелью под CD и сенсорными кнопками по сторонам.
Цитата:
IR
ISP
IBus
Sensor Kay
Encoder
Radio Kay, Kay0 Kay1 Kay2
Вложений: 1
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Хотел посоветоваться, где лучше сенсорные кнопки разместить? по бокам или на нижней горизонтальной планке? голову сломал не могу решить.
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Смотря как часто будешь пользоваться. Если очень редко, то мое мнение лучше с нижнего торца монитора (опять же,если он выдвижной), а если часто то на полочке рамки.
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Цитата:
Сообщение от
Крестик
Смотря как часто будешь пользоваться. Если очень редко, то мое мнение лучше с нижнего торца монитора (опять же,если он выдвижной), а если часто то на полочке рамки.
Думаю лучше сделаю по бокам. Потому как кнопки будут с подсветкой и при нажатии подсветка будет ярче чем обычно, чтоб видно было что кнопка была нажата. (2 смд светодиода разной яркости 1 обычный как на всей подсветке в машине 2 яркий при нажатии будет загораться второй)
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Re: Проэкт вживления компа в BMW Е46 по кличке "Борька"
Цитата:
Сообщение от
Крестик
Плату сам травил?
да сам, если надо кому исходник в формате layout, спрашивайте в личке. Моя плата думаю мало кому понадобиться но если под Arduino Mega что то делать то пины уже готовые.